Sub: An appeal for the certificate course in HIV/AIDS by Social Activities Integration (SAI), Mumbai

Respected sir/madam,

Social activities integration is a non-profit ,non-political, NGO working mainly to decrease the incidence and prevalence of HIV/AIDS & STIs. At present there are 10 different projects running through SAI. Certificate course in HIV/AIDS is a new project. The basic aim of this new project is capacity-building of those members of society who directly or directly deal with HIV/AIDS.(doctors , ,paramedical, counselors, out-reach staff etc.)The course is absolutely free . The lectures will be taken by eminent professors and leading practitioners Student from 1st, 2nd, 3rd, & 4th year are welcome for the courses.
